Rockabye Baby has transformed 13 of Linkin Park’s most popular songs into soothing lullaby versions featured on their new release, Lullaby Renditions of Linkin Park, which is out on Friday (September 26). Replacing Linkin Park’s signature guitars and intense production with gentle instruments like bells and xylophones, the album includes tranquil versions of that band’s hits such as “In the End,” “One Step Closer,” and “New Divide,” aiming to calm listeners and families alike. Known for creating instrumental lullabies of major artists like The Beatles, Beyoncé, Taylor Swift, Snoop Dogg, Coldplay, and Adele, the Los Angeles-based Rockabye Baby offers a unique way for music fans both young and old to experience a softer side of Linkin Park’s music. Meanwhile, Linkin Park has recently concluded the North American leg of their From Zero World Tour, with a series of upcoming European dates and festival appearances stretching into 2026.
